My legs are proving to be very very strong during long runs. They are taking longer to fatigue. I am also beginning to believe that fuel 2-3 days prior to the long run is much more important than the day before. After many days of experimentation - I have decided that my weight should be around 53 kgs (118lbs) on the day of my marathon and this takes into account the fact that I might lose 3-ish kilos during the run. It is the weight at which I perform the best.

I took 2 electrolyte tablets today to keep my weight stable - I have a tendency to lose 5kgs just very easily during a run. I have also been refueling with copious amounts of pretzels dipped in peanut butter. I am exactly a month away from Sundown - yikes!

21 miles @ 155 minutes (2hrs and 35minutes). Average pace 7.30min/mile. Very very happy with this. I have been passing men that should be faster than me.

Anyway, this is my achilles heel where important runs are concerned, so I am glad its out of the way. Ideally, its my last 20-plus run before my marathon. May the tapering (sort of) begin!
